CALL NUMBER: T4031:0006 SUPPLIED TITLE OF TAPE(S): Dreams of freedom : Niels Hansen RECORDED: Victoria (B.C.), 1982-03-04 SUMMARY: Niels Hansen discusses: arriving in Holberg in November 1911, age 7 years old; uncle already in Cape Scott- he was marriage commissioner, Justice of Peace; work was hard to get at this time; father bought out local store; hard life in Cape Scott at this time; logged for 2-3 years, starting at age 15; worked in cannery; then went to sea as a cook; fishing; looking for work in Quatsino, Port Alice; life at the canneries; going to dances; more on fishing.; CALL NUMBER:
T4031:0007 SUPPLIED TITLE OF TAPE(S): Dreams of freedom : Niels Hansen RECORDED: Victoria (B.C.), 1982-03-04 SUMMARY: Niels Hansen discusses: fishing (cont'd); competition in hard times amongst fishermen in the area; wolf stories; anecdotes about cougars; geese, ducks and deer; going to school in Holberg, Cape Scott; Mr. Christensen; uncle, Knud Hansen was early settler. Mrs. Nancy Hansen discusses: arriving in San Josef Bay in 1915; father cleared land and created farm; few neighbours- once a month there was a get-together at Lake Erie; celebrations at Christmas, New Year's; a lonely life, especially for young people; managed to make own amusement; married in 1922 on beach at San Josef; people had to leave because there were no opportunities; parents.;
